Gusties Show Their Skills at Undergraduate Statistics Research Project Competition

Congratulations to current MCS student Kaylee Vick and MCS alumni Ha Le,  and Rachel Erickson for winning  Honorable Mention in the Undergraduate Statistics Research Project Competition!  Their work looked at student buy-in for standards-based grading in Calculus I.  The data was provided to them by Dr. Jeff Ford ’02  and their work was supervised by Dr. Jillian […]
